How do I get my aloe Vera to grow more vertically?

I love my aloe Vera plant, but am low on space. Is there a way to get her to grow straighter upwards and not lean outwards so much? #AloeVera #Aloe #Succulents

If you can increase her light that will help her grow more upright. But you will need to acclimate her to it slowly so she doesn't get burnt.

You can also get some twine and a few stakes. Put 3 stakes in the pot and then tie some twine around the stakes to add some support. I know it's not always possible to increase light. โค๏ธ
